Czy wiesz, że aż 88% użytkowników nie wróci do strony internetowej po złym doświadczeniu? W dzisiejszym świecie, gdzie konkurencja online jest coraz większa, skuteczne projektowanie UX dla aplikacji webowych staje się kluczem do sukcesu. Dzięki właściwemu podejściu do interakcji użytkownika oraz jego potrzeb, możemy znacząco poprawić satysfakcję użytkowników i zwiększyć konwersje. W tym artykule przyjrzymy się, czym jest UX dla aplikacji webowych i jakie zasady powinny kierować jego projektowaniem, aby skonstruować doświadczenia, które zachwycają i angażują.
UX dla Aplikacji Webowych: Co To Jest?
UX dla aplikacji webowych to proces koncentrujący się na poprawie satysfakcji użytkowników poprzez stworzenie pozytywnego doświadczenia w interakcji z aplikacją.
Kluczowym celem projektowania UX jest zapewnienie, aby aplikacje były zrozumiałe i intuicyjne. Aby to osiągnąć, niezbędne są szczegółowe badania użytkowników, które pomagają zrozumieć ich potrzeby oraz oczekiwania.
Podstawowe elementy UX obejmują:
-
Badania użytkowników: Zbieranie danych na temat preferencji i zachowań użytkowników, co pozwala na lepsze dopasowanie funkcjonalności aplikacji do ich oczekiwań.
-
Architektura informacji: Struktura organizacji treści, która ułatwia nawigację i odnajdywanie potrzebnych informacji w aplikacji.
-
Interaktywność: Tworzenie płynnych i responsywnych interakcji, które sprawiają, że użytkownicy czują się komfortowo podczas korzystania z aplikacji.
-
Testowanie użyteczności: Ocena aplikacji przez rzeczywistych użytkowników, które pozwala na identyfikację problemów oraz obszarów do poprawy.
Zainwestowanie w UX dla aplikacji webowych przynosi wymierne korzyści. Dobrze zaprojektowane interakcje poprawiają zadowolenie użytkowników, co przekłada się na wyższą lojalność i zwiększenie konwersji.
Bez wątpienia, UX odgrywa kluczową rolę w sukcesie aplikacji webowych, ponieważ skuteczne projektowanie wpływa na postrzeganie marki, budując pozytywne doświadczenia użytkowników.
Kluczowe Zasady Projektowania UX dla Aplikacji Webowych
Kluczowe zasady w projektowaniu UX opierają się na głębokim zrozumieniu użytkowników oraz ich emocji.
Przede wszystkim, skupienie na użytkownikach jest podstawą efektywnego projektowania. Należy identyfikować potrzeby, cele i oczekiwania użytkowników, aby tworzyć rozwiązania, które odpowiadają ich wymaganiom.
Przejrzystość to kolejna zasada, która odgrywa kluczową rolę. Użytkownicy oczekują, że interfejsy będą intuicyjne, a informacje łatwo dostępne. Dzięki przejrzystości, ograniczamy frustracje i poprawiamy doświadczenia użytkowników.
Równie istotna jest spójność w projektowaniu. Warto zdefiniować jednolity styl wizualny oraz zasady interakcji, które pomogą utrzymać jednolite wrażenie i ułatwią użytkownikom poruszanie się po aplikacji. Spójność buduje zaufanie i zapewnia komfort podczas korzystania z rozwiązania.
Minimalizm również jest kluczowym elementem. Usunięcie zbędnych elementów, które mogą rozpraszać uwagę, pozwala skoncentrować się na najważniejszych funkcjach. Proste, ale eleganckie interfejsy sprzyjają lepszemu doświadczeniu.
Nie można zapominać o emocjach użytkowników. Projektowanie powinno uwzględniać, jak użytkownicy czują się w interakcji z produktem. Pozytywne emocje wpływają na ich zaangażowanie i satysfakcję.
Podsumowując, efektywne projektowanie UX wymaga skupienia na użytkownikach, przejrzystości, spójności oraz minimalizmu, aby emocjonalne reakcje użytkowników wpływały na их przywiązanie do aplikacji.
Zastosowanie tych zasad w praktyce prowadzi do tworzenia wartościowych i satysfakcjonujących doświadczeń w używaniu aplikacji webowych.
Proces Projektowania UX dla Aplikacji Webowych
Proces projektowania UX dla aplikacji webowych składa się z kilku kluczowych etapów, które są niezbędne do stworzenia wydajnego i intuicyjnego doświadczenia użytkownika.
Pierwszym krokiem są badania użytkowników, które mają na celu zrozumienie potrzeb, oczekiwań oraz zachowań grupy docelowej. Może to obejmować wywiady, ankiety oraz analizę istniejących danych. Zebrane informacje pozwalają na definiowanie głównych problemów oraz wymagań, które muszą zostać uwzględnione w designie.
Kolejnym etapem jest tworzenie interaktywnych prototypów. Dobrze zaprojektowany prototyp umożliwia wizualizację idei i pozwala na prezentację głównych funkcji aplikacji. Prototypy mogą mieć różne poziomy szczegółowości, od makiet lo-fi po bardziej zaawansowane wersje hi-fi. Dzięki nim zespół projektowy może testować różne rozwiązania oraz zbierać feedback od użytkowników, co znacząco wpływa na proces projektowania.
Następnie przeprowadzane jest testowanie użyteczności. To kluczowy etap, który polega na obserwowaniu, jak użytkownicy korzystają z prototypu. Testy te pomagają zidentyfikować trudności, które mogą napotkać użytkownicy oraz sprawdzić, czy interfejs jest intuicyjny. Na podstawie zebranych danych możliwe są iteracyjne poprawki w projekcie.
Ostatnim krokiem jest wprowadzenie poprawek i optymalizacja rozwiązania, co prowadzi do końcowego wdrożenia produktu. Cały proces projektowania UX jest iteracyjny, co oznacza, że każda faza jest powiązana z wcześniejszymi, a każde wprowadzenie zmian opiera się na analizie uzyskanych informacji.
Utrzymywanie ciągłej komunikacji z użytkownikami oraz ich feedback są kluczowe dla sukcesu projektu. W efekcie, starannie przeprowadzony proces projektowania UX umożliwia tworzenie aplikacji, które są nie tylko estetyczne, ale przede wszystkim funkcjonalne i dostosowane do realnych potrzeb użytkowników.
Badania Użytkowników w UX dla Aplikacji Webowych
Badania użytkowników są kluczowe w tworzeniu skutecznego UX dla aplikacji webowych. Pozwalają one na zrozumienie potrzeb i oczekiwań użytkowników, co jest fundamentem udanego projektowania.
Jednym z podstawowych narzędzi w badaniach użytkowników jest analizy person użytkownika. Tworzenie person polega na identyfikacji różnych segmentów docelowej publiczności, co umożliwia lepsze zrozumienie ich motywacji, zachowań i potrzeb. W efekcie, projektanci mogą dostosować interfejs do specyficznych preferencji.
Kolejnym istotnym elementem jest analiza konkurencji. Badanie, co oferują inne aplikacje w danej niszy, pozwala na zidentyfikowanie mocnych i słabych stron istniejących rozwiązań. Dzięki temu, można zaprojektować unikalne funkcjonalności, które wyróżnią aplikację na rynku oraz wypełnią luki pozostawione przez konkurencję.
Wizualizacje i narzędzia wykorzystywane w badaniach użytkowników, takie jak ankiety, wywiady czy testy użyteczności, dostarczają cennych danych, które mogą być użyte do iteracyjnego doskonalenia produktu. Prawidłowo przeprowadzone badania umożliwiają stworzenie rozwiązań skoncentrowanych na użytkownikach, co prowadzi do wyższego poziomu satysfakcji i lojalności klientów.
W rezultacie, inwestycja w badania użytkowników nie tylko przynosi wymierne korzyści w postaci lepszego UX, ale także wpływa na sukces całego projektu, augmentując jego pozycję na rynku.
UX a SEO w Aplikacjach Webowych
UX i SEO są ze sobą ściśle powiązane, ponieważ dobre doświadczenie użytkownika przekłada się na lepsze wyniki SEO.
Zadowoleni użytkownicy spędzają więcej czasu na stronie, co zwiększa wskaźniki angażowania, takie jak współczynnik odrzuceń. Dobrze zaprojektowane aplikacje webowe redukują ten wskaźnik, co wpływa pozytywnie na ranking w wyszukiwarkach.
Poprawa konwersji jest kluczowym elementem, który można osiągnąć poprzez efektywne UX. Wysoka jakość interfejsu zachęca użytkowników do działania, co zwiększa szanse na końcową konwersję, taką jak dokonanie zakupu czy zapisanie się na newsletter.
Z drugiej strony, dostępność aplikacji webowych również odgrywa istotną rolę w SEO. Skrócenie czasu ładowania strony, optymalizacja nawigacji oraz dostosowanie treści dla osób z różnymi potrzebami sprawia, że aplikacje są bardziej przyjazne i dostępne dla wszystkich. Wspieranie dostępności przyczynia się do zwiększenia bazy użytkowników oraz ich zadowolenia, co również wpływa na SEO.
Aby osiągnąć sukces w SEO, warto skupić się na następujących aspektach:
-
Optymalizacja prędkości ładowania – Aplikacje powinny ładować się szybko, aby nie zrażać użytkowników.
-
Intuicyjna nawigacja – Uproszczone menu oraz jasna struktura strony pomagają użytkownikom w łatwym poruszaniu się po aplikacji.
-
Czytelna treść – Przyjazny styl pisania oraz dobrze widoczne przyciski mogą zwiększyć zaangażowanie.
Dzięki ścisłemu połączeniu UX i SEO, można znacząco poprawić widoczność aplikacji w wynikach wyszukiwania oraz zapewnić lepsze doświadczenie dla użytkowników.
Narzędzia do Testowania UX w Aplikacjach Webowych
Na rynku dostępnych jest wiele narzędzi UX, które wspierają projektantów w procesie testowania użyteczności. Te platformy do testowania UX są kluczowe dla zrozumienia, jak użytkownicy wchodzą w interakcje z aplikacjami webowymi.
Kluczowe narzędzia do testowania UX:
-
UsabilityHub
Umożliwia przeprowadzanie różnorodnych testów, w tym testów kliknięć i preferencji. Pozwala na zbieranie wartościowych informacji o tym, jak użytkownicy postrzegają interfejs. -
Lookback
Platforma ta umożliwia prowadzenie sesji testowych w czasie rzeczywistym, co pozwala na zbieranie feedbacku od użytkowników podczas ich interakcji z aplikacją. Oferuje również nagrywanie sesji dla późniejszej analizy. -
Optimal Workshop
Narzędzie, które oferuje zestaw funkcji do badania architektury informacji i efektywności nawigacji. Pomaga w zrozumieniu, jak użytkownicy przeszukują informacje w aplikacji. -
Hotjar
Umożliwia analizy zachowań użytkowników za pomocą map ciepła oraz nagrywania sesji. To doskonałe narzędzie do zrozumienia, które elementy aplikacji przyciągają uwagę oraz gdzie występują problemy. -
UserTesting
Platforma, która pozwala na szybkie przeprowadzanie testów użyteczności na szeroką skalę. Umożliwia dotarcie do różnych grup użytkowników i zbieranie ich opinii w różnorodnych kontekstach.
Korzyści z zastosowania narzędzi do testowania UX:
-
Zbieranie feedbacku: Umożliwiają projektantom uzyskanie bezpośrednich opinii od użytkowników, co jest kluczowe dla dalszego rozwoju aplikacji.
-
Analiza interakcji: Narzędzia do testowania użyteczności dostarczają danych o tym, jak użytkownicy korzystają z aplikacji, co pomaga zidentyfikować obszary do poprawy.
-
Poprawa ogólnej jakości UX: Dzięki regularnym testom można stale dostosowywać interfejs do potrzeb użytkowników, co prowadzi do zwiększenia ich satysfakcji.
Wykorzystanie tych narzędzi do testowania UX w aplikacjach webowych to kluczowy krok w kierunku tworzenia bardziej intuicyjnych i użytecznych rozwiązań, które przyciągają i zatrzymują użytkowników.
Projektowanie aplikacji webowych
Projektowanie aplikacji webowych to złożony proces, który ma na celu stworzenie efektywnych, użytecznych i estetycznych rozwiązań, dostosowanych do potrzeb użytkowników. Kluczowym elementem tego procesu jest zrozumienie wymagań użytkowników oraz celów biznesowych klienta.
W ramach projektowania aplikacji webowych wyróżniamy kilka istotnych etapów:
-
Warsztaty koncepcyjne: Zbieranie informacji na temat potrzeb użytkowników oraz celów biznesowych, co pomaga w tworzeniu wstępnych założeń projektowych.
-
Tworzenie makiet: Przygotowanie lo-fi (niskiej rozdzielczości) i hi-fi (wysokiej rozdzielczości) makiet, które ilustrują koncepcję interfejsu oraz jego funkcjonalności.
-
Prototypowanie: Stworzenie interaktywnego prototypu, który umożliwia testowanie rozwiązań z użytkownikami, co pozwala na wczesne wychwycenie ewentualnych problemów i wprowadzenie poprawek.
-
Testowanie użyteczności: Weryfikacja, jak użytkownicy korzystają z aplikacji oraz identyfikacja obszarów do poprawy.
-
Przygotowanie plików gotowych do wdrożenia: Po akceptacji prototypu, projektanci dostarczają pliki graficzne, które są gotowe do implementacji przez programistów.
W trakcie procesu projektowania ważne jest, aby współpraca między projektantami a zespołem programistycznym była ścisła, co zapewnia spójność i jakość finalnego produktu.
Koszt stworzenia designu interfejsu aplikacji webowej zależy od wielu czynników, w tym:
- Poziom skomplikowania aplikacji
- Liczba funkcji do wdrożenia
- Czas potrzebny na badania i testy
- Doświadczenie zespołu projektowego
Zlecenie projektowania UI specjalistom pozwala na uzyskanie intuicyjnego interfejsu, co znacząco wpływa na zadowolenie użytkowników oraz konwersję. Użytkownicy preferują aplikacje, które są nie tylko estetyczne, ale przede wszystkim funkcjonalne.
Projektowanie aplikacji webowych to inwestycja, która przynosi długoterminowe korzyści, poprawiając satysfakcję użytkowników i zwiększając wyniki biznesowe firmy.
UX dla aplikacji webowych to klucz do sukcesu w dzisiejszym świecie cyfrowym.
Zrozumienie zasad projektowania doświadczeń użytkownika oraz zastosowanie efektywnych narzędzi w procesie tworzenia aplikacji może znacząco poprawić satysfakcję klientów.
Zastosowane strategie powodują nie tylko wzrost użyteczności, ale również przyciągają nowych użytkowników i zwiększają ich zaangażowanie.
Inwestycja w UX dla aplikacji webowych jest zatem krokiem, który pozwala wyróżnić się na konkurencyjnym rynku i osiągnąć długotrwały sukces.
Zadbaj o swoje aplikacje, a rezultaty będą widoczne w pozytywnych opiniach użytkowników.
FAQ
Q: Co to jest projektowanie UX/UI?
A: Projektowanie UX (User Experience) zach focuses na satysfakcji użytkownika, a UI (User Interface) dotyczy estetyki oraz funkcjonalności interfejsu. Oba elementy są kluczowe dla sukcesu aplikacji.
Q: Jakie są etapy procesu projektowania UX/UI?
A: Proces projektowania obejmuje badania rynku, analizy użytkowników, wireframing, prototypowanie oraz testowanie użyteczności, co pozwala na doskonałe dopasowanie produktu do potrzeb użytkowników.
Q: Jakie zasady są kluczowe w projektowaniu UX/UI?
A: Pięć podstawowych zasad to: projektowanie skoncentrowane na użytkowniku, przejrzystość, spójność, rozpoznanie ograniczeń poznawczych oraz możliwość personalizacji interfejsu.
Q: Dlaczego warto zlecić projektowanie UI specjalistom?
A: Zlecenie projektu UI profesjonalistom gwarantuje intuicyjność interfejsu, co przekłada się na większe zadowolenie użytkowników oraz wyższe wskaźniki konwersji i efektywność biznesową.
Q: Jakie są przykłady aplikacji z doskonałym UX?
A: Przykłady to Spotify, Airbnb, Netflix, Uber, Google Maps, Duolingo, WhatsApp, Instagram, Tinder i Evernote, wszystkie cechują się intuicyjnym interfejsem oraz wysoką satysfakcją użytkowników.
Q: Jak projektowanie UX/UI wpływa na sukces aplikacji?
A: Dobre projektowanie UX/UI zwiększa satysfakcję i lojalność użytkowników, co prowadzi do lepszej konwersji i pozytywnego wizerunku marki, kluczowych dla sukcesu aplikacji.
